! gales.f90
! module in which all the routines for gale calculation are held
! contains: GaleScore, GaleIndex, GetGaleThresh

module Gales

use StanGeneral

implicit none

contains

!*******************************************************************************
! function to calculate gale score (0=no gale,1=gale,2=severe gale,3=very severe gale)
! obtained from Hulme+Jones,1991,Weather 46:126-136

function GaleScore (Speed,Thresh1,Thresh2,Thresh3)

real GaleScore
real 		:: Speed
integer 	:: Thresh1,Thresh2,Thresh3
real, parameter :: MissVal = -999.0

if (Speed.NE.MissVal.AND.Thresh1.NE.MissVal.AND.Thresh2.NE.MissVal.AND.Thresh3.NE.MissVal) then
  if      (Speed.GE.Thresh3) then
    GaleScore = 3
  else if (Speed.GE.Thresh2) then
    GaleScore = 2
  else if (Speed.GE.Thresh1) then
    GaleScore = 1
  else
    GaleScore = 0
  end if
else
  GaleScore = MissVal
end if

end function GaleScore

!*******************************************************************************
! function to calculate gale index
! obtained from Hulme+Jones,1991,Weather 46:126-136

function GaleIndex (FVal,ZVal)

real GaleIndex
real 		:: FVal,ZVal
real, parameter :: MissVal = -999.0

if (FVal.NE.MissVal.AND.ZVal.NE.MissVal) then
  GaleIndex = sqrt ((FVal ** 2.0) + ((0.5 * ZVal) ** 2.0))
else
  GaleIndex = MissVal
end if

end function GaleIndex
